The International Youth Initiative Program (YIP) is a 10 month residential societal entrepreneurship training for 18-28 years olds based in Sweden. YIP offers you a holistic educational program that expands global understanding and personal awareness.

YIP aims to strengthen young people’s capacity to take personal and collective initiative in the face of current global realities.

Up to 40 participants learn, create and organize alongside experts, facilitators and innovators.
YIP’s curriculum provides a platform for young people to expand their understanding, develop their fullest potential and find their authentic tasks in society and the world.

The term “societal entrepreneur” as used by YIP describes people and initiatives that base their actions in service of society and understand the world as one interconnected living organism. This paradigm points to the interconnectedness of global systems and new ways of working toward a more equitable world. Through allowing young people to explore this paradigm and, with it, face and develop themselves and society, YIP seeks to support these young people to become leaders of a new, more sustainable and integrated lifestyle and future.


Basic Requirements

  • 1) age
    You have to be between 18 – 28 years old to participate in the program.
  • 2) english
    You need to be able to understand, speak, read and write English at an intermediate level. This is based on our experience of participants requiring at least this level to be able to engage meaningfully in the courses. Certification is required if English is your second language.

  • 3) application fee
    We will only process your application once the non-refundable application fee of SEK 750 has been received. You will receive an application fee confirmation email once this has been processed by YIP. Please save this proof of payment as its submission is required to complete your application.
  • 4) Program fee
    The Program Fee for YIP is SEK 100,000 per participant for the whole 10 months.
    It includes:
    • The Curriculum: courses, course materials and evening activities.
    • Food: organic meals (breakfast, lunch and dinner from Monday to Friday, not including weekends and holidays).
    • Accommodation: shared twin bedroom, in communal house with shared bathrooms, kitchens and living area.
    • Travel: SEK 8,000 for the travel to and from the Outpost and International Internships.
    • Transportation: in connection with the curriculum.

YIP Diversity fund

Despite its international character, the YIP participant group often lacks representation from different socio-economic demographics. Because the content of YIP often focusses on global challenges as well as an individual capability to take on multiple perspectives, it is essential that there is a diverse range of backgrounds, cultures, and experiences present at YIP.

In order to meet this need, the YIP Diversity Fund strives to support 2-4 participants who would benefit and thrive from attending this type of education but otherwise wouldn’t be able to.

This fund is not a large body of money that refills each year, but it is a result of ongoing efforts by participants and alumni through bake-sales, grant writing and small donations.

In order to apply to the YIP Diversity Fund you must fulfill the following requirements:
  • You must be accepted through the normal YIP acceptance procedure
  • You have no other means of paying the YIP tuition
  • You show initiative and actively engage with the YIP organisation

The amount of money there is in the fund differs each year. Typically it supports people with a partial scholarship of 25-50%. The Diversity fund only considers people that have already been accepted to the program, as a first step please complete the application process.
